About The Bookstore for Horse Lovers
The Bookstore for Horse Lovers is a virtual bookstore is a unique platform dedicated to highlighting authors of horse books and connecting with readers in their niche. Readers may search featured authors, fiction authors, and non-fiction authors, read their official biographies, follow them on social media and click through to the designated purchase site provided by the author.
